Ryan Tannehill is taking a big step closer to becoming the Miami Dolphins’ starting quarterback.

Tannehill will start tonight’s preseason game at Carolina, according to broadcaster Dick Stockton, who calls play-by-play on the Dolphins’ preseason broadcasts.

Several recent reports have indicated that Tannehill is the best quarterback in Dolphins camp at the moment, especially after David Garrard went down with a knee injury last week. Tannehill is a rookie, but he’s a rookie who played for offensive coordinator Mike Sherman in college and therefore has more experience in the offense than Garrard or incumbent starter Matt Moore.

If Tannehill plays well tonight, he may just follow Andrew Luck, Robert Griffin III and Brandon Weeden and become the NFL’s fourth rookie starting quarterback this season.
